Maersk Line will be reducing capacity to the Pacific Southwest. This move includes the current TP5 service as of January 15th, 2015; and Maersk Line will cease offering direct Taiwan Express product to the Pacific Southwest as of January 1st, 2015. For the shippers using the current TP5 service today, North China and Korea markets will be covered by Maersk Line’s new East-West network, that will be launched this January, and will provide best-in-class transit times.  For the Japan market, effective from January 16th, 2015, Maersk Line will launch a new TP5 product with reduced capacity covering Busan, Yokohama, Los Angeles, and Oakland.
